Cost of hiring a professional christmas light installer

When hiring a professional to install your holiday lights, there are several factors that you should consider. First, make sure you get multiple quotes. Cheap installation companies may use sub-par lights and less experienced designers. The best way to avoid being ripped off is to be choosy about who you hire. Getting several quotes will give you a better idea of how much different Christmas light installers charge. Also, it will help you recognize when a particular professional is overcharging you or undercharging you.

Another factor to consider is the size of your yard. If your home has multiple trees or diverse landscaping, the cost of installation will be higher. It is also important to find out whether there are any restrictions on how much light you can use. Some neighborhoods will only allow a certain amount of light coverage around a tree, so be sure to check before hiring a professional. Lastly, you should book your service as early as possible. Most of the time, professional Christmas light installers are booked months in advance. Therefore, it is a good idea to book your service in September or October.

When you hire a professional Christmas light installer, you can also hire them to install new electrical wires for your lights. This will cost you about $100 an hour, depending on the time you need the installation to complete. A good installer will provide you with extension cords and stakes to hold the lighting in place. They will also supply you with timers for your holiday lights. You may even be able to get battery-powered lights for your wreaths.

The cost of hiring a professional to install Christmas lights varies widely. The average cost of a holiday light installation is around $200 to $400, depending on the amount of square footage and whether the lights are provided by the installer. Some companies offer free estimates or email quotes so that you can compare prices and make a decision based on your budget.

While hiring a professional Christmas light installer may seem like a great way to save money, it is important to consider the size and complexity of the project before you hire one. Costs can include materials and labor. Some companies will charge you a flat rate, while others may charge by the linear foot. Also, some companies may charge extra if your home has a tall roof.
